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Apperley Bridge to Penshurst start from as little as £46.10

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Apperley Bridge to Penshurst start from £79.30 one way

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Apperley Bridge to Penshurst are available for £176.90 one way

Station Details & Facilities

At Apperley Bridge, ticket purchasing is streamlined albeit straightforward. While there's no traditional ticket office, ticket machines are conveniently available at the station for both purchases and collections. However, keep in mind that these machines are not accessible. The presence of an induction loop compensates for this by aiding those with hearing impairments. As a Category A station, Apperley Bridge ensures step-free access throughout, making navigation easier for all, despite the absence of tactile pavings.

While facilities like luggage storage, waiting rooms, and even a basic seating arrangement are lacking, the station is under the constant watch of CCTV, providing a secure environment for passengers. It's also worth mentioning that you won't find toilets or refreshment options here, so plan accordingly. Parking is available with 98 standard and 6 accessible spaces, and the good news is—parking here is free!

Station Facilities and Accessibility

Penshurst Station is straightforward in its offerings, providing essential services for those embarking on a journey. While there isn't a ticket office, travelers can still collect tickets purchased online via accessible ticket machines. The station features an induction loop for the hearing impaired and support for travelers with disabilities is available through help points.

Accessibility is a mixed bag at Penshurst. While some facilities are step-free, certain areas of the station aren't. Specifically, there is step-free access to both platforms via separate entrances, but there is no step-free transition between platforms. Assistance can be pre-arranged, or accessed by using on-board train staff when available. The station lacks waiting rooms, toilets, and refreshment facilities, which travelers should keep in mind when planning their visit.
